A mysterious post from Sega has sparked excitement among fighting game enthusiasts, leading many to believe the publisher is teasing the arrival of Virtua Fighter 6. In 2023, Sega surprised fans by announcing several revival projects for its long-dormant franchises, igniting hope for more beloved titles to return.

Among the most notable revivals are Crazy Taxi, Jet Set Radio, and Streets of Rage. However, many fans had hoped for a resurgence of the Virtua Fighter series as well. Although no official announcement has been made yet, the demand for a new installment is palpable.

Sega has even acknowledged the potential for a new Virtua Fighter game. Shuji Utsumi, co-COO of Sega Corporation and CEO of Sega of America, indicated that the classic 3D fighting game series is overdue for a revival. The last mainline entry, Virtua Fighter 5, was released in 2006 and later remade using the Dragon Engine, re-emerging as Virtua Fighter 5 Ultimate Showdown on PlayStation 4 in 2021.

A Cryptic Tweet Fuels Speculation

Recently, Sega shared a cryptic image on its official Twitter account, prompting gamers to speculate that it might be hinting at Virtua Fighter 6. The tweet appeared on the Japanese Sega account and featured the word "Sega" repeated 54 times, challenging fans to identify the one that stood out. Notably, in the second row and second column, "Sega" is rendered as "SE6A," leading to widespread belief that the inclusion of the number 6 could signal a new installment in the Virtua Fighter series.

Ongoing Rumors About a New Title

Speculation about a new Virtua Fighter game has been brewing throughout 2024, with rumors suggesting it may take on an esports focus akin to the competitive shifts seen in Tekken 8 and Street Fighter 6. Some reports hint at the possibility of a reboot that pays homage to the original 1993 arcade game.

Despite claims from sources suggesting that a reveal was imminent this year, recent developments have cast doubt on their reliability. If Sega’s latest post indeed points toward Virtua Fighter 6, it's intriguing that the publisher opted not to unveil anything during the September 2024 Tokyo Game Show or Evo 2024, which would have garnered significant attention for the project.

The most likely venue for a potential Virtua Fighter announcement now seems to be The Game Awards 2024, especially since Sega revealed several classic revivals during last year's event. However, fans are advised to manage their expectations, as this post could ultimately refer to something less significant.
